Damaged roof replacement in Sudbury, MA, involves removing and replacing sections of a roof that have sustained significant damage. Understanding the typical scope and factors involved can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.

  •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, each with different durability and cost considerations.
  • Size and scope: The extent of damage determines whether only localized sections or the entire roof requires replacement.
  • Labor complexity: Steep slopes, multiple layers, or difficult access can increase labor time and difficulty.
  • Permitting: Local Sudbury permits are typically required for roof replacements, especially if structural changes are involved.
  • Additional considerations: Items such as flashing, ventilation, or insulation upgrades may be included or added as extras.
